We’ve seen a significant interest in properties in Dighton, MA, reflecting the dynamic nature of the Dighton real estate market. The median price of homes for sale in Dighton was $494,500 in December 2023, which is a decrease of 0.9% since last year. The typical home value of homes in Dighton MA is $517,744, which has gone up 5.4% over the past year

Dighton Neighborhood Info

Dighton is a town located in Bristol County, Massachusetts. It is bordered by the cities of Fall River and Taunton and the town of Raynham. According to the 2020 census, the town’s population is 8,126. Dighton was first settled in 1627 and was officially incorporated in 1712. The town is named after Frances Dighton Williams, the wife of one of the original settlers.

The town of Dighton is home to a number of historical landmarks like Coram Shipyard Historic District, Dighton Community Church, 1798, and Dighton Wharves Historic District.

Dighton is a fantastic place to stay if you like outdoor activities. The Dighton Rock State Park is a popular spot for hiking and picnicking. The park has the Dighton Rock, a massive boulder covered in what is believed to be petroglyphs left behind by Native Americans. The rock is currently on display at the nearby Fall River Heritage State Park.

Sweets Knoll State Park is another great spot for hiking, fishing, and picnicking. The park is also home to the Dighton Public Library, which was built in 1892.

And don’t forget about the annual Cow Chip Festival! This fun event is held each year in honor of Dighton’s agricultural history. It features a number of family-friendly activities, including a cow chip throwing contest, live music, and more.
